The Geometry of Connectivity: Design and Build


The most striking feature of these adapters is their 90-degree angled design. This L-shaped form factor is not merely an aesthetic choice; it is a fundamental engineering decision aimed at solving common cable routing challenges. The compact dimensions of the adapter housing, clearly depicted in the product images, suggest a minimal footprint, allowing for installation even in constrained environments.

This specific geometry directly implies a cleaner, more organized setup. When a straight HDMI cable is plugged directly into a device, it often extends several inches outwards before bending, creating unsightly loops or putting strain on the port. The 90-degree bend redirects the cable immediately, allowing it to run flush against a wall or the back of a media cabinet. This is particularly beneficial for wall-mounted televisions or monitors, where every millimeter of depth is critical. A clean setup is achievable.

Traditional straight connectors, while functional, inherently create a leverage point that can damage the HDMI port over time. The constant pressure from a stiff cable bending sharply can loosen the port's internal connections or even crack the housing of the device itself. These angled adapters mitigate this by absorbing the initial bend, thereby protecting the more delicate and expensive port on the source or display device. This is a subtle yet significant advantage.

Considering the Constraints: Practical Trade-offs


While these adapters offer numerous advantages, it is important to acknowledge certain practical considerations. The addition of any adapter, no matter how compact, introduces an extra connection point in the signal path. While the gold plating minimizes signal loss, the physical presence means a slight increase in the overall length of the connection at the port. This could be a factor in exceptionally shallow clearances.

Furthermore, the 90-degree design, while beneficial for most scenarios, requires the user to select the correct orientation. An adapter designed to bend a cable to the left will not be suitable if the desired routing is downwards. This means careful consideration of port orientation and cable direction is necessary during purchase, potentially requiring different types of angled adapters for various ports on a single device.
